What is ADHD Assessment?
ADHD assessment is a detailed assessment of a person's habits, feelings, and cognitive function to identify if they display signs constant with ADHD. This assessment serves several functions. It can verify a diagnosis and help in creating a customized treatment plan, enabling people to manage their signs effectively.
Why is ADHD Assessment Important?
ADHD assessment is essential for a number of factors:

ADHD assessment generally involves several actions. The following table sums up the different stages:

A range of tools and procedures are utilized to evaluate ADHD symptoms. Here are some typically used tools:

Rating Scales
Conners Rating Scale: Evaluates behavioral, emotional, and scholastic issues in children and adolescents.Vanderbilt Assessment Scale: Assesses hyperactivity, impulsivity, and negligence in addition to existing together conditions.
Behavioral Checklists
ADHD Rating Scale-IV: A tool to help examine the frequency of ADHD signs based upon moms and dad and instructor reports.
Cognitive Assessments
Wechsler Intelligence Scale for Children (WISC): Measures cognitive capability and locations consisting of verbal comprehension and working memory.
Observation Protocols
Observations in different contexts, such as home and school, aid assess the consistency of ADHD symptoms throughout environments.
Clinical Interviews

The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-5) lays out particular requirements for ADHD diagnosis. The main symptoms fall under 2 categories:

Inattention Symptoms
Trouble sustaining attention in tasksFrequent reckless mistakes in schoolworkTrouble organizing jobs and activities
Hyperactivity and Impulsivity Symptoms
Fidgeting or tapping hands/feetProblem staying seated in situations where it is anticipatedDisrupting or intruding on others' discussions
A diagnosis of ADHD typically needs that a number of signs have continued for a minimum of six months and proof considerable disability in social, academic, or occupational performance.
